Vanilla Texas Sheet Cake w/Cream Cheese Frosting
- Ready In:
- 45mins
- Ingredients:
- 15
- Serves:
-
10-15
ingredients
- 2 2⁄3 cups all-purpose flour
- 1⁄2 cup margarine
- 1 cup water
- 1 1⁄2 teaspoons baking soda
- 2⁄3 cup buttermilk
- 2 cups sugar
- 1⁄2 cup vegetable oil
- 2 eggs
- 1 1⁄2 teaspoons vanilla
-
Cream Cheese Frosting
- 1⁄2 cup margarine
- 1 (8 ounce) package cream cheese, softened
- 1 1⁄2 cups coconut (optional)
- 1 1⁄2 teaspoons vanilla
- 1 (1 lb) box powdered sugar
- 1⁄2 cup chopped pecans (optional)
directions
- Mix flour and sugar together in bowl, Bring to boil, margarine, oil and water, pour over flour and sugar mixture.
- Beat well.
- Then add eggs, baking soda, vanilla and buttermilk, mix well.
- Pour into greased and floured 15x10 jelly roll pan.
- Bake in a preheated oven at 350 degrees for 15-20 minutes or until cake tests done with toothpick.
- Remove from oven while still warm frost with cream cheese frosting.
- Cream together margarine, cream cheese, the add vanilla, coconut, nuts and powdered sugar.
- Mix well, spread warm cake.

I made this cake exactly as listed, baked it for the full length (20 minutes), it was cooked through, but still quite wet. Maybe that is how it was supposed to be, I am trying to remember if my chocolate sheet cake is that wet. I thought is was a good cake, but wanting a bit more flavor. Maybe next time I might experiment a bit and add some coconut extract to the cake and toast the nuts and coconut before putting in the frosting. Most likely, I will be making this cake again!
